Delhi Administration vs Gurdip Singh Uban And Ors. Etc

Citation / case number
AIR 2000 SUPREME COURT 3737
Court
Supreme Court of India
Petitioner
Delhi Administration
Respondent
Gurdip Singh Uban And Ors. Etc
Author
M. Jagannadha Rao
Bench
S.B. Majmudar, M. Jagannadha Rao

Judgment text excerpt

The Supreme Court upheld the land acquisition proceedings in the case of Delhi Administration v. Gurdip Singh Uban, citing the precedence of Abhey Ram v. Union of India, [1997] 5 SCC 421 over Delhi Development Authority v. Sudan Singh, [1997] 5 SCC 430. The Court dismissed the review petitions filed by Gurdip Singh Uban, stating that a plea for review must show manifest distortion of the original judgment. The Court clarified that the applicants could approach the authorities regarding land release but upheld the original acquisition order.
